How can I activate my roaming outside in the Philippines?

Text ROAM ON to 333 before you travel. When back in the Philippines, text ROAM OFF to 333 to subscribe to local offers.

How do I check my Globe broadband bill via text?

Every month, you’ll receive a text message informing you that your bill is ready. A link will be provided in the message. You’ll get the passcode via text once you click on the link. After entering the passcode, you’ll be able to view and download your bill.

How can I know my Globe plan due date?

All due dates are 21 days after the billing cycle cutoff date. If you have a desired due date in mind, you can choose your cut-off date from the following dates: the 5th,15th, 26th, and end of every month.

How do I open Globe modem inbox?

STEP 1: Go to http://192.168.254.254/ and log in through your username and password. You may locate these credentials at the back of your modem.

What is your account billing cycle?

A billing cycle, also referred to as a billing period, is the interval of time between billing statements. Although billing cycles are most often set at one month, they may vary in length depending on the product/service rendered. Typically, the billing cycle lasts anywhere between 20 and 45 days.

How long does a Globe plan last?

For your plan options, you can choose between GPlan with a device or with GCash which comes with a 24-month contract, or GPlan PLUS which is a line-only plan with 12 months contract.
